Basic Settings

Storing phone numbers for speed dialing

Each dialing station can store a phone number up to 30 digits in length and the associated station name up

to 10 alpha-numeric characters.

Notes:

To enter

a

hyphen in a phone number, press the LOWER key.

• If you make a mistake while programming, press the STOP button, then make the correction.

• To erase a programmed phone number in step 3, press the STOP button when the cursor is positioned on

the beginning of the number.

• Confirm that phone numbers and their station names have been correctly stored by printing the telephone

number list (see page 50).

To keep a phone number secret

Use this feature to keep a whole phone number or a portion of a phone number secret. When the telephone

number list is printed out (see pages 50 and 51), secret numbers will not be printed.

Using the SECRET (direct cali station 3) button:

Press the

SECRET button before and behind the phone number you wish

to keep secret.

Example:

The phone number you wish to keep secret is 12345.

Press

SECRET, 12345 and SECRET again.

<A01>=[12345

Note:

• Pressing the SECRET button once counts as two digits.
